⚠️ Education Below the Graduate Level
To qualify, you generally fall into one of the following categories:
- You are an employee of the eligible educational institution.
- You were an employee of the eligible educational institution, but you retired or left on disability.
- You are a widow or widower of an individual who died while an employee of the eligible educational institution or who retired or left on disability.
- You are the dependent child or spouse of an individual described in (1) through (3), above.
📝 Additional Qualified Tuition Reduction Details
Child of deceased parents
For purposes of the qualified tuition reduction, a child is a dependent child if the child is under age 25 and both parents have died.
Child of divorced parents
For purposes of the qualified tuition reduction, a dependent child of divorced parents is treated as the dependent of both parents.
